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Heathrow to Lewes is to drive which costs £15 - £23 and takes 1h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Heathrow to Lewes is to drive which takes 1h 16m and costs £15 - £23.
No, there is no direct train from Heathrow to Lewes. However, there are services departing from Heathrow Terminals 2 & 3 and arriving at Lewes via Paddington station and London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 56m.
The distance between Heathrow and Lewes is 69 miles. The road distance is 64.6 miles.
The best way to get from Heathrow to Lewes without a car is to train which takes 1h 56m and costs £35 - £95.
It takes approximately 1h 56m to get from Heathrow to Lewes, including transfers.
Heathrow to Lewes train services, operated by Southern, depart from London Victoria station.
Heathrow to Lewes train services, operated by Southern, arrive at Lewes station.
Yes, the driving distance between Heathrow to Lewes is 65 miles. It takes approximately 1h 16m to drive from Heathrow to Lewes.
